Activities 2015-2016 World Environmental Day 2015 was celebrated at TVKV School, Vaniyambadi, Vellore District on June 06, 2015. Ullam Foundation member Mr. Niganandhan delivered speech on „Environmental Pollution and Prevention Methods‟ to the school students. Quiz competition based on environmental issues was conducted to the school students and prizes were distributed to the winners. Ullam Foundation has sponsored two students to continue their college education during the academic year 20152016. Ms.P.Madhumitha to purse B.Com (First Year) at Sacred Heart College (Autonomous), Tirupattur and Mr.K.Vijay to purse DEEE (First Year) at Government Polytechnic College, Korukkai, Thiruthuraipoondi. Workshop on “Higher education and jobs after schooling” was conducted on November 07, 2015 at Government Higher Secondary School, Vallipattu Village, Vaniyambadi Taluk. During this program, the detailed description about the courses available in Engineering & Technology, Medical Science, Arts, Science, Law, Commerce and Management and their respective job opportunities were explained to the students. This program was inaugurated by the school Head Master Mr.Annadurai. The sessions were handled by our members Mr.B.Deepanraj, Mr.G.Arunkumar and Mr.B.Vinothraj. More than 100 student participants from +2 were participated in the workshop.
The 2015 South Indian floods resulted from heavy rainfall affected the Coromandel Coast regions of Tamilnadu, specifically Chennai and Cuddalore. Support towards Chennai and Cuddalore District flood relief was made through Ullam Foundation on 12/12/2015. Flood relief materials worth of Rs.21,840/- such as mats, bed sheets, medicines, dresses, food materials like biscuit, bread and water bottles were supplied to the needy people. Our members Mr.S.Niganandhan, Mr.A.Santhoshkumar, Mr.B.Deepanraj and Mr.R.Pachaiyappan collected these materials and handed over them to the affected persons. Republic Day Speech and Essay Competition was conducted by Ullam Foundation at Panchayat Union Elementary School, Echangal Village, Vaniyambadi Taluk on January 26, 2016. On the same day, Elocution and drawing competition was conducted at Panchayat Union Elementary School, Periya Kurumba Theru, Alangayam Block, Vaniyambadi Taluk. Certificates and prizes were given to the winners of each events. Complementry prizes were given to encourage participants.
Ullam Foundation has received VIPNET (network of Indian Science Clubs) affiliation from VIGYAN PRASAR (http://www.vigyanprasar.gov.in), an autonomous organisation under Department of Science & Technology, Government of India on February 16, 2016. The Unique Authorisation Number for the club is VP-TN0033. This affiliation was given to promote the activities related to Science and Technology.
